What function Does Oxidation Participate in during the Efficacy Of Iron Filtration devices?

Filtration procedures are critical in guaranteeing that you've got entry to clear and Safe and sound consuming h2o. When you are working with higher amounts of iron with your h2o, comprehension the job of oxidation in iron filtration systems is important for maximizing their success.

Iron arrives mainly in two varieties: ferrous (dissolved) and ferric (particulate). The oxidation procedure converts ferrous iron into ferric iron, which appreciably impacts your filtration procedure's capability to clear away iron from water.

When you have ferrous iron inside your h2o, it can be soluble and invisible till it oxidizes to sort ferric iron. Once ferric iron is shaped, it precipitates out in the drinking water, which will allow your filtration procedure to entice these more substantial particles.

primarily, oxidation causes it to be probable to your filtration unit to seize iron that may usually keep on being dissolved and not be taken out. In the event your procedure is intended to take care of iron, the oxidation procedure happens using several techniques, like aeration, chemical oxidation, or catalytic oxidation.

Aeration is among the most basic and mostly used methods for iron oxidation. In this process, air is released to the h2o, allowing for ferrous ions to respond with oxygen. This response converts ferrous iron to ferric iron proficiently.

If you decide for an aeration procedure in your house, you can expect to detect that it don't just aids with iron removing but may additionally boost the overall aesthetic quality of the water. even so, ensure that right maintenance is applied to keep the aeration method performing optimally.

Chemical oxidation may also be an option for you. Chemicals like chlorine or potassium permanganate can explicitly target dissolved iron and change it to some solid type that can be filtered out. This approach is usually notably helpful in additional severe h2o ailments in which substantial amounts of iron are existing.

When utilizing this technique, it can be essential to control the dosing accurately to stop over-oxidation, which often can introduce other unwelcome byproducts into your water.

Besides aeration and chemical treatment, catalytic oxidation methods are becoming more and more well known. They use Particular media that aid the oxidation of iron without the want for additional substances or aeration gear.

These programs could be very efficient and could involve less maintenance than standard products, generating them a protracted-expression expense for yourself.
